Museum of Wood
Museum of Wood is a museum in Carmelo, Colonia Department which is located on Doctor Juan Zorrilla de San Martín. Museum of Wood is situated nearby to the bus station Intertür, as well as near Berrutti.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Carmelo is a city in the Rio de la Plata region of Uruguay, popular for its wineries, golf, and coastline.

Zagarzazú or Balneario Zagarzazú is a resort village in the Colonia Department of southwestern Uruguay. Zagarzazú is situated 6 km northwest of Museum of Wood.
